Melissent, 

Hancock has closed brass rings hiding in brown cardboard boxes on shelves
in the back of the decorator fabrics section.  They may not be out and
visible; you may have to open some boxes to find them.  There are usually
other ring-like items in the same set of shelves to give you a hint,
though.  The Sterling Annex to Ponte Alto could probably be persuaded to
make a field trip sometime.  ;)  I use 'em on my Italian Ren gowns.
